Output e5dbb5e5e5306d86f256b2b660173aaad0f870c7817c498a177d8b2684bcc760:1

value
1760000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f66df4e458964c81a166747c696dbea99f4db9e OP_EQUAL
address
3K94Dsiatttws5fmPYm8sP5DxrBk7dqFXw
transaction
e5dbb5e5e5306d86f256b2b660173aaad0f870c7817c498a177d8b2684bcc760
spent
true